Robotron, I suppose. The basic idea is a large arena filled with large quantities of mostly a single type of monster. Briefly fun on the 'zombie' levels, because they shoot each other for great justice. A slog on every other level. Odd lapses include level with single revanant, level with two revenants, etc; obviously running out of inspiration. Last level has no monsters. Levels 31 and 32 levels tribute to Wolfenstein, v. clever.
